Jeté is a signature ballet movement requiring time, dedication, commitment and great skill to create the illusion of boundless control. The same commitment and skill is engaged in the making of our méthode traditionnelle wines in an endeavour to create wines of finesse, refinement, elegance and poise.
From our growing experience of the Mount Barrow site and the making of méthode traditionnelle wines, the Grand Jeté style is evolving. The vineyard naturally delivers a fine, mineral line of acidity which sets the style as aperitif – crisp and bright. It is generously fruit-driven and the dosage is crafted to balance the fine acidity.
TASTING NOTE
Vintage
A wine crafted from the noble sparkling grapes of Chardonnay and Pinot Noir, radiating the classic varietal characteristics of citrus, white stone fruit and mixed berries. Aromas of shortbread, meringue and apple tart emerge alongside an underlying mineral edge of oyster shell and shale. Vibrant freshness is evident, as flavours of white grapefruit, lemon pith and finger lime mingle seamlessly. Almond and gingersnap notes become apparent in turn, due to 52 months spent on lees in tirage. A refined and sophisticated bead dances delicately over the palate, amidst a harmony of citrus fruits and green apple, leading to an energetic minerality that unfurls to a lengthy, mouthwatering finish.
Food Match
Enjoy with sashimi tuna and wakame salad.
Recommended Cellaring
Drink now until 2029.
